Abstract Text
The long range goal of this research is to probe the active site regions of
replicative DNA polymerases and to uncover similarities and differences
among them by the use of selective, active-site-directed inhibitors. The
ability of these and related compounds to stop the growth of cells involved
in disease states may be of value in designing drugs for the treatment of
cancer and viral infections.
The general class of inhibitors that are the subject of this work are
N2-substituted 2-aminopurines, their 2'-deoxyribonucleosides and
5'-triphosphates of the latter. Techniques of organic synthesis and
structure determination, separation methods, enzymology and cell culture
will be employed to achieve the following specific aims: 1) synthesis and
testing of deoxyribonucleotide analogs as inhibitors of and substrates for
mammalian cell DNA polymerase alpha to explore the structure of the active
site of the enzyme; 2) preparation and exploitation of inhibitor-based
affinity columns for the purification of DNA polymerase alpha; 3)
examination of the mechanism of cytotoxicity of inhibitors toward mammalian
cells, and their potential anabolism or catabolism by cellular enzymes; and
4) synthesis and testing of N2-substituted-2'-deoxyguanosine
5'-triphosphates for inhibition of Herpes simplex virus type 1 DNA
polymerase, and antiviral activity of suitable base or deoxyribonucleoside
derivatives.
